Q&A

Do smart gates meet pool safety and liability standards in Minnesota?

Yes. Integrated IoT gate systems with automatic self-closing and latching mechanisms meet the ICC ISPSC 2021 code, which requires a 48-inch minimum height and positive latching. These smart systems provide audit trails and remote status checks, which are becoming standard for managing liability in Minnesota, especially with the moderate trend toward smart-gate integration.

Why do fence posts in Independence City Center need footings below 42 inches?

The frost line depth is 42 inches in Independence. Footings set above this line are subject to frost heave, which lifts posts and destroys fence alignment. IRC Section R403.1.4.1 mandates footings below the frost line to prevent structural failure. In this neighborhood, posts not set to this depth will fail within two winters.

What are the legal requirements for replacing a shared fence line in Independence?

Minnesota Statute 344.03, the 'good neighbor' law, requires written notice to adjoining property owners before constructing or replacing a partition fence on a shared boundary. As of 2026, this notification is a prerequisite for permit approval in Independence. Failure to provide notice can result in legal disputes and permit revocation.

What fencing materials are suitable for Independence's soil and pest conditions?

The soil has a moderate corrosivity index. This requires hot-dip galvanized steel posts and brackets to prevent rust failure. Termite risk is slight, making pressure-treated wood a viable option, but all fasteners must be stainless steel or hot-dip galvanized to prevent rust streaks that degrade appearance and structural integrity over time.

How does the 115 MPH V-ult wind rating affect fence design in Independence?

The V-ult wind speed of 115 MPH is the ultimate design wind speed. This rating, per ASCE 7-22 standards, dictates post spacing, concrete footing size, and bracket strength. A fence in this area must be engineered to resist peak storm season gusts, which often requires closer post spacing (e.g., 6 feet on-center instead of 8 feet) and commercial-grade hardware.

What are the height and setback rules for fences in Independence, MN?

Zoning limits are 4 feet in front yards and 6 feet in rear yards. The setback is 0 feet, meaning a fence can be built on the property line with a permit. Corner lots have critical 'sight triangle' regulations. Near MN-12, any fence within the sight triangle must be under 3 feet tall to maintain driver visibility and comply with city code.
